How to fill out historic farmstead inventory form

Illustration

How to fill out HISTORIC FARMSTEAD INVENTORY FORM

01
Begin by reading the instructions provided with the HISTORIC FARMSTEAD INVENTORY FORM carefully.
02
Fill out the basic information section, including the name of the property, address, and the date of the inventory.
03
Provide a detailed description of the farmstead, including the size, layout, and any significant structures.
04
Document the historical significance by noting any events, people, or agricultural practices associated with the farmstead.
05
Include photographs of the property, ensuring they capture important features and buildings.
06
List any known renovations or changes that have been made to the farmstead over the years.
07
Review the completed form for accuracy and completeness before submission.

The Historic Farmstead Inventory Form is a document used to collect and record detailed information about historic farmsteads, including their architectural features, historical significance, and condition.
Individuals or entities that own or manage a historic farmstead in a specified region or jurisdiction are typically required to file the Historic Farmstead Inventory Form.
To fill out the Historic Farmstead Inventory Form, gather necessary information about the property, including its history, architecture, and any relevant photographs. Follow the form's instructions to provide the required details systematically.
The purpose of the Historic Farmstead Inventory Form is to document and preserve the historical and architectural significance of farmsteads, aiding in the protection and promotion of cultural heritage.
Information reported on the Historic Farmstead Inventory Form typically includes the farmstead's location, historical background, architectural features, condition, ownership, and any alterations made over time.
